Card face

What it does

Exile all creature cards from target player's graveyard. You may cast spells from among those cards for as long as they remain exiled, and mana of any type can be spent to cast them.

As Frodo put on the Ring, Sauron was suddenly aware of the magnitude of his own folly. His wrath blazed in consuming flame, but his fear rose like black smoke.

Provenance

Where it came from

Shadow of the Enemy was released as part of the Magic: The Gathering—The Lord of the Rings: Tales of Middle-earth set in 2023. This card, specifically carrying the collector number 107s as a promotional variant, was introduced to highlight key narrative moments from J.R.R. Tolkien’s legendarium, focusing on the dark influence of Sauron and the temptation of the One Ring.

The artwork was commissioned from illustrator Shahab Alizadeh, who sought to capture the oppressive, ethereal atmosphere of the antagonist's reach. The design emphasizes the mechanical theme of card theft and mimicry, reflecting how the shadow of the enemy manifests by turning an opponent's own tools against them. It was well-received by players for its thematic resonance and the evocative, atmospheric style characteristic of the set's broader art direction.
